#2 Kumar Sangakkara

Kumar Chokshanda Sangakkara, the former Sri Lankan cricketer and captain currently appears as a commentator for various cricket matches. He was a left-handed wicket-keeper batsman.

Sangakkara is the only player in Sri Lanka to reach 14,000 runs in ODI format. He made his Test debut in 2000 against South Africa and he also holds the record to have scored above 150 runs in four consecutive test matches. He took part in different leagues across the world. In Srilanka Premier League (SPL), he played for Kandurata Warriors as captain.

In 2000, Sangakkara made his ODI debut against Pakistan. He is the only batsman to have scored four consecutive centuries in the 2015 ICC World Cup and he is the second best in the world when it comes to most number of dismissals effected as wicketkeeper in World cup after Adam Gilchrist. Sangakkara leads the ODI wicketkeeping charts with the most number of dismissals to his name.

Sri Lanka have struggled a lot without the services of Kumar Sangakkara.
